K-Way to open third UK store at Covent Garden’s Seven Dials

15th September 2026 | Jack Oliver

French outerwear brand K-Way is set to open its third store in the UK at Covent Garden’s Seven Dials neighbourhood.

Opening at 19 Earlham Street in October, the retailer’s new 1,200 sq ft space will offer K-Way’s signature windbreaker jackets alongside a variety of jackets, fleeces, and apparel for men, women, and children. K-Way also partners with high-end fashion and streetwear brands, such as Fendi, Saint Laurent, Ami Paris, Kappa, and Universal Works.

The new store will become the brand’s second within Shaftesbury Capital’s portfolio, joining K-Way on Carnaby Street in Soho.

William Oliver, director of retail and restaurant leasing at Shaftesbury Capital, said: “The strength of our portfolio lies in the distinct character of each of our neighbourhoods and our long-term approach to curating a mix of brands that enhances these destinations. K-Way has already established a strong presence on Carnaby Street, and its decision to open a second location with us in Covent Garden reflects both the appeal of the neighbourhood and the confidence brands have in our stewardship of London’s West End.”

Lorenzo Boglione, CEO of the BasicNet Group, added: “The opening of our third K-Way monobrand store in the UK marks another important milestone in our strategy to strengthen the brand’s presence in one of Europe’s most dynamic retail markets. Following the successful openings on King’s Road in 2025 and Carnaby Street in 2026, Covent Garden was a natural next step: one of the city’s most iconic destinations, renowned for its shopping, culture and international visitors. As we continue to expand our retail network, our goal is to offer an immersive brand experience that fully expresses K-Way’s heritage, innovation and contemporary lifestyle vision.”
